Port Isabel Drone Services FAQ

Can AeroFrohne map a Port Isabel marina or waterfront parcel?

Potentially, when property permission, launch space, operating activity, airspace, and safety conditions support the mission. The land, structures, docks, and shoreline context are scoped separately from reflective or moving water, which may not model reliably.

How are boats, docks, and channel traffic handled during capture?

The site contact should identify vessel movements, dock operations, restricted areas, and preferred work windows. Moving boats and water can create inconsistent imagery, so capture is timed to reduce conflict and the deliverable limits are defined before flight.

What Port Isabel deliverables can a project team request?

Options can include a GeoTIFF orthomosaic, visible-condition photographs, DSM, land-surface contours, point cloud, CAD/GIS exports, construction progress views, selected quantities, and a textured 3D model where site conditions support reconstruction.

Does nearby coastal airspace change the quote or schedule?

It can. AeroFrohne checks the exact Port Isabel address against current airspace and operating restrictions, then accounts for authorization needs, safe altitude, adjacent activity, and launch and recovery areas in the feasibility and schedule.

What information helps scope a Port Isabel construction site?

Provide the address, mapped boundary, acreage, project phase, site-contact details, desired resolution and outputs, access rules, and any active waterfront, road, utility, or construction operations that must be coordinated.
